Growth eases for manufacturing sector
Growth in China’s manufacturing sector cooled slightly last month as foreign demand for Chinese goods slackened, but a governmentled infrastructure push kept construction humming and helped prop up the world’s second-largest economy. The official Purchasing Managers’ Index held above the 50-point mark that separates growth from contraction for the 12th straight month, as China poured funds into a construction boom that has fuelled demand for everything from cement to steel and other building materials.
